What are some common challenges senior machine learning engineers face when deploying models to production, and how can they be addressed?

Senior Machine Learning Engineers often encounter challenges related to model scalability, maintaining performance in real-world scenarios, and ensuring reliable integration with existing systems. Addressing these challenges typically involves thorough testing, implementing robust monitoring for model drift, and collaborating closely with DevOps and software engineering teams to streamline deployment pipelines. Staying updated on best practices in MLOps and adopting tools for automated deployment and monitoring can greatly improve the reliability and efficiency of production models.

What does a senior machine learning engineer do?

A Senior Machine Learning Engineer designs, develops, and implements machine learning models to solve complex problems. They are responsible for selecting appropriate algorithms, preprocessing data, and optimizing model performance. Additionally, they collaborate with data scientists, software engineers, and product teams to integrate machine learning solutions into production systems. Senior engineers also mentor junior team members and contribute to setting technical direction for machine learning projects.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ior machine learning eng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Senior Machine Learning Engineer, you need advanced knowledge of machine learning algorithms, statistical modeling, and programming languages like Python or Java, typically sup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Experience with frameworks and tools such as TensorFlow, PyTorch, scikit-learn, and cloud platforms, as well as familiarity with version control and CI/CD systems, is essential. Strong problem-solving, communication, and leadership skills help you collaborate effectively and mentor junior team members. These capabilities are crucial for designing scalable ML solutions and driving impactful results within complex, dynamic projects.

What is the difference between Senior Machine Learning Engineer vs Data Scientist?

AspectSenior Machine Learning EngineerData Scientist
Required CredentialsBachelor's/Master's in CS, ML, or related; experience with ML frameworksBachelor's/Master's in CS, Statistics, or related; strong analytical skills
Work EnvironmentDevelops and deploys ML models in production systemsAnalyzes data, builds models, and provides insights
Industry UsageTech, finance, healthcare, e-commerceResearch, finance, marketing, tech

While both roles require strong technical skills and knowledge of machine learning, Senior Machine Learning Engineers focus more on deploying scalable ML solutions in production environments, whereas Data Scientists primarily analyze data and develop models for insights. The roles often overlap but differ in their core responsibilities and focus areas.

About the Opportunity:

As a Manufacturing Engineer III, you build on your experience and technical judgment to lead moderately complex manufacturing efforts, drive process improvements, and support production readiness across aerospace manufacturing operations. You will take ownership of projects and initiatives that improve quality, cost, and productivity, working closely with cross-functional partners to resolve manufacturing challenges. As a senior engineer, you will provide guidance and informal mentorship to less-experienced engineers, contribute to best practices and standard work, and support a culture of continuous improvement and learning.

Location: This position is remote with 50%+ travel - including international - to provide support to the sites within the division

Responsibilities:

  • Lead CNC turning and milling manufacturing efforts, providing technical direction and support for complex setups, programming strategies, and process optimization.
  • Own the development, validation, and continuous improvement of manufacturing process plans, ensuring robust, repeatable, and compliant production.
  • Develop, review, and optimize CNC programs to improve quality, cycle time, and cost, while supporting standardization and best practices across programs.
  • Serve as a primary manufacturing engineering point of contact for customer interactions, supporting issue resolution, blueprint interpretation, and implementation of engineering changes.
  • Lead tooling design, sourcing, and implementation efforts, balancing manufacturability, cost, and long-term production needs.
  • Lead root cause analysis and corrective action efforts for complex or recurring production issues, ensuring sustainable solutions are implemented.
  • Drive process improvement initiatives focused on first-pass yield, throughput, and equipment uptime, with measurable performance results.
  • Evaluate, justify, and support implementation of new equipment, tooling, and manufacturing technologies to improve operational performance.
  • Provide senior-level technical guidance and informal mentorship to junior and mid-level engineers, supporting skills development and engineering consistency.
  • Develop and review cost estimates for products, tooling, equipment, and processes, supporting quoting, capacity planning, and business decisions.
  • Ensure manufacturing documentation-including process instructions, CNC programs, SOPs, and setup sheets-is accurate, standardized, and maintained.
  • Support compliance with Pursuit Aerospace quality systems, safety requirements, and regulatory standards, promoting best practices within daily operations.
  • Lead Kaizen workshops
  • Operate in a hands-on environment where engineers are expected to be on the shop floor 50%+ of the time supporting the operators and operations

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ering and at least 7 years of aerospace manufacturing engineering experience OR 10 years of aerospace manufacturing experience
  • Must be authorized to work in the U.S. on a full-time basis without sponsorship now or in the future. The Company cannot offer employment to visa holders who require employer sponsorship in the future or cannot work now on a full-time basis.
  • Must be able to perform work subject to ITAR/EAR regulations.

Preferred Qualifications:

  • 3 years emphasis in airfoil and single blade milling
  • Mechanical, Manufacturing, or Aerospace Engineering degree is preferred.
  • Experience working in an AS9100 environment
  • CAD skills preferred - NX / Solid Edge
  • CNC milling and turning or precision machining experience.
  • Proficiency in CNC programming, tooling design, and advanced manufacturing processes.
  • Proficient in PFMEA, Control Planning, and measurement system analysis (MSA)
  • Ability to work with metrology equipment or inspection in process control
  • Strong knowledge of Lean Manufacturing and Six Sigma principles, Six Sigma Green Belt certified preferred
  • Advanced problem-solving and analytical skills with the ability to manage multiple projects.
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ills to effectively collaborate across teams and with customers.
  • Proficiency in CAD software, ERP systems, and advanced Microsoft Office tools.
